hi i was wondering if its at all possible to connect an xbox 360 to a yamaha htr5540rds av reciever,i havent got a hd tv just an old sony wega any help would be most welcome

If I am not mistaken your Sony TV should have a "variable audio out" that could be connected to your Yamaha (AVR). Since it is an older set this would carry all of the audio going into the TV back out to the AVR.
If the TV doesn't have the audio out connectors then the Red/White RCA audio cables from your XBox should be connected to your receiver. That may take some RCA couplers such as:
